python3数据分析学习笔记,python3 数据分析

kodinid 3 0

大家好,今天小编关注到一个比较意思的话题,就是关于python3数据分析学习笔记问题,于是小编就整理了5个相关介绍Python3数据分析学习笔记的解答,让我们一起看看吧。

  1. Python笔记:调用函数,带扩和和不带括号的区别?
  2. 我是经济学专业大二学生,未来想从事金融,想自己学一下关于数据分析(Python)方面,应该怎么学?
  3. 有哪些能够提升数据分析思路的书?
  4. 作为一名研究生,除了可以用python写各种算法之外,还应该如何提高自己的python水平?
  5. 零基础学习了Python,现在想学Python Web开发,需要学什么?

Python笔记:调用函数,带扩和和不带括号区别

def cun (a,b):return a+bprint(cun) : 调用函数,打印的是函数print(cun(2,3)),调用函数运行结果,打印的是 5

我是经济学专业大二学生,未来想从事金融,想自己学一下关于数据分析(Python)方面,应该怎么学

题主经济学大二生,将来目标是金融行业,这是很不错的职业规划,竞争虽然激烈但确实有钱途。至于说数理工具数据分析等等是否要下大力气学习,这是当然的,对将来工作很有用,但是,却不是最重要的。对金融行业就业来说,什么最重要?

python3数据分析学习笔记,python3 数据分析-第1张图片-安济编程网
图片来源网络,侵删)


学历背景

金融就业对学历,对出身,很高,非常高,不管是投行,债券,还是基金都是如此。国内金融高端就业领域对毕业生所就读大学院校的要求很变态,顶级的只要清华经管,连清华五道口院都以研究岗为主;北大光华汇丰CCER还有现在慢慢出头的燕京;复旦经管交大高金安泰,当然还有人大等这些最顶尖的高校,实事求是的说,其它学校机会很少。举个例子,BATM招聘,最后录取的投资部成员,都是清北毕业,且不乏哈佛、耶鲁等藤校背景的。再比如国内某著名基金,只要本科就是清北的,清北硕士都不行。出身,很重要。


金融专业有很强的地域性,记住:重要的不是金融学还是金融工程数据分析计算机技术,而是各种实习背景的安排,没有实习,没有强有力的实习,实力无从体现,找工作一样没戏。什么叫“强有力”?一般小券商的实习,四大事务所的实习,都没多大用。

python3数据分析学习笔记,python3 数据分析-第2张图片-安济编程网
(图片来源网络,侵删)


清北的金融本,大部分都去米国英国了,去哥大伦敦政经巴黎高商看看,乌泱乌泱的。若非如此,一般985两财一贸考清北复交的金融研上不了岸。

金融经济学跟其他专业不太一样,它是非常注重实操的行业,专业上需要学习的东西不太多,也没有想象中的难度。金融业从业,人脉,关系,朋友圈,比投资技术重要。所以,题主学不学数据分析没那么关键,重要的是考研,提升自己,能出去就出去,出去也必须瞄准米国前十英法顶级,出不去当然死掐清北复交至少是985两财一贸,再把实习背景做做好。

题主有志于金融行业,当然没毛病。只是有一点一定要提醒一下,这是个投入比较大的专业,资金投入,时间投入,精力投入都很多,尤其是实习,要有心理准备。

python3数据分析学习笔记,python3 数据分析-第3张图片-安济编程网
(图片来源网络,侵删)

好一点的经济金融专业岗位,现在看来不太可能本科就去就业,绝大部分得读个研深造一下。一般无非就是两个出路:保研,或者出国。

总算碰到一个比较不错的问题了!

数据分析学习路线

一 当然是python的基础语法,另外sql的语法也要重点学习一下

二 学习python主流的数据分析框架:Pandas、numpy、matplotlib

建议使用工具:pycharm

三 重点学习下python数据分析相关的算法,一定要注意多思考,重在理解

四 前三点完成之后,可以在leetcode上进行练习

第一步:学习Python语言基础,它的各种语法、用法。这个过程因人而异,有的人喜欢看书,这里推荐《Python编程入门实践》,边看边跟着做,就能掌握Python的基本用法;有的人喜欢看视频,现在网络发达很好找,比如B站、慕课网,搜一下就有。在此期间,可以看看廖雪峰等人的博客、Github上的学习笔记等。

第二步:学习数据分析所需要的库,这里主要是numpy、pandas、matplotlib等。推荐书籍为《用Python进行数据分析》,这本书作者是pandas的缔造者,里面很多示例,跟着敲就能通晓数据分析应该怎么做。

第三步:学习一定的爬虫知识机器学习。数据怎么来?除了用别人的,有的时候还需要自己收集,这就需要用到爬虫。建议直接看崔庆才的爬虫***,B站有。而数据分析跟机器学习是形影不离、相辅相成的,网上教程也是一大堆,入门的话推荐吴恩达的网课版,注意不是斯坦福上课那个。

学习完前面的步骤,基本上就能自己开始数据分析了。遇到困难,多百度,多提问,逐步掌握。

双修统计应用数学类专业,或辅修计算机大数据方向课程

经济学虽然有经济统计专业课程,但与数据分析还是有差距,不系统不深入。

热门职业竞争厉害,其他专业转方向搞大数据分析与挖掘,不系统学习是不可能胜出的。

有哪些能够提升数据分析思路的书?

《精益数据分析》是阿利斯泰尔·克罗尔和本杰明·尤科维奇,这两位作者混迹在[_a***_]硅谷的科技圈、创业圈多年,接触了非常多美国一线创业公司最前沿的精益创业案例,并且将这些案例写在了书中,对他们进行归纳总结。

在说这本书之前,我们要先了解,什么叫作精益创业。精益创业诞生于互联网行业,是软件开发的新模式。以价值***设和最简化可实行产品(MVP)为重要论点。通俗地说,就是用最小的成本和最快的速度试错。在市场中投入一个极简的产品原型,然后通过用户需求反馈去不断地迭代产品,以适应市场。

而《精益数据分析》这本书,就是详细了解释了精益创业以来,应该如何以数据来驱动企业的经营发展,用哪些指标来衡量自己的成败。这本书的前八章还是比较干货的,比较多有思考性的内容,而后面的内容则是比较多的实例,按照企业和产品的特点进行了分类,可以根据自己的需要去阅读就可以。

最近一些年,对于数据分析的要求越来越高,无论是什么岗位,都会要求掌握一定的数据分析。实际上数据分析不太难,很多时候思路要高于技术,应该如何去选择数据,这些数据可以解析出什么结果,如何去构建一套数据体系,这些思维性的内容难点要高于技术性的分析手段。

而《精益数据分析》这本书,可以说是一本很好的数据分析入门书籍,阅读完这本书,有以下几点比较大的收获:

这是我第一次听到关于“第一关键指标法”的概念,此前是有“北极星指标”的概念。“第一关键指标法”和“北极星指标”的区别在于,第一关键指标不是公司的唯一重要性指标,而是任意一个环节,肯定只有一个最关键的指标。

作为一名研究生,除了可以用python写各种算法之外,还应该如何提高自己的python水平?

谢邀!

研究生应该会写很多论文吧,可以针对自己所学到的技术知识,外加查询一些文献等等,可以向一些媒体机构投稿,一是可以赚取一些稿费,还有就是对自己的毕业答辩或者以后的就业都是很有帮助的。

平时可以写写自己的博客,在博客上不仅可以学到很多大神的技术,还能通过写博客,提升自己的技术。

如果有足够的野心,Python的应用范围是很多的,比如web应用开发自动化运维,网络爬虫,大数据分析,图像处理科学计算,游戏桌面软件人工智能等等

条件的话,可以开始接触一些实战项目,在实战中提高自己的技术水平!

  1. python

    最接近人类的语言,学习起来特别容易上手。只会一门语言是不够的,会影响对编程语言的理解。在研究生阶段最好再入门Java或者C,有比较,更易理解Python语言的编程思想,语言的优劣。笔者就是写过一段时间Python,工作需要用了一段时间J***a,再回过头用Python,领悟许多。
  2. 看优秀Python包的源码,建议看Google或者其他的大厂的开源小Python项目,看了不同人的代码风格才知道自己差距在哪。然后,根据实际尝试写一个包发布到

    pypi.org

    。动手做才能看到忽略的细节。

  3. Python写算法,基本上的意思是会调机器学习的scikit-learn、深度学习的TensorFlow等。这些不能帮助理解一门语言的核心思想。建议尝试用Python写一个web项目,做做网页或者写写接口。会做一个服务是日后工作的必修课。

  4. 最后一条也是最重要一条:学会使用Pycharm,按住“Ctrl”或"Command"后,点击函数,进入代码内部查看。

大方向来说,Python的用处一个是开发后端,Django Flask Tornado这些框架常规的框架,还有Sunic这样小众的,

再一个就是数据科学,从最开头的网络爬虫,各种网站的数据抓取 抓到之后可以卖数据,也可以构建自己的数据集,再进一步就是数据分析,海量数据的应用啊 分析什么的

最后就是AI,人工智能领域

就像是练武功一样,不同的语言终究是招式,一招一式皆有套路可循,算法 数据结构这些才是内功

除了学习算法,也可以学习做界面,做爬虫,做工程,比如做一个网站,基于爬虫进行信息聚集,加工挖掘,然后展示给用户,也可以挖掘做产品,多看看github成熟的项目,看看python和大数据的集成

Python当中学到了算法这个部分,我们就要考虑进阶或者是提升。简单的说一下,Python的进阶流程:了解基本语法--->熟练使用常用的库--->Pythonic--->高级玩法--->看透python的本质;

Web Programming: Django, Pyramid, Bottle, Tornado, Flask, web2py

GUI Development: wxPython, tkInter, PyGtk, PyGObject, PyQt

Scientific and Numeric: SciPy, Pandas, IPython

Software Development: Buildbot, Trac, Roundup

System Administration: Ansible, Salt, OpenStack

零基础学习了Python,现在想学Python Web开发,需要学什么?

Python Web如何学习:

一般我们带学生的时候,都会首先让大家明确学习目的。题主自己提到了下一步要学习的是Python web相关的知识点。那么接下来给大家分享一张Python学习的线路图:

首先不知道楼主的Python基础掌握的程度,如果按照上图已经掌握了第一个阶段的话,建议学习第二阶段,Python和Linux高级之后我们再去学习前端开发和web开发。

Linux系统应用:Linux发行版系统的使用、基本的语句

网络编程:TCP/IP协议服务器工作过程

并发编程:线程进程、协程

函数高级应用:熟练使用函数的调用等

正则表达式:熟练舒勇re模块的各种方法

数据库:关系型数据库、非关系型数据库、mysql

Python语法进阶:闭包、装饰器、生成器、迭代器

需要进行更多的练习,熟能生巧,练得多了,很多问题见到了自然就知道怎么去处理了。每天都坚持练习,保证一定的代码量,然后做笔记,定期回去复习,保存好写过的代码,坚持度过这段时期就会好很多了。

Python学习重点掌握的知识点,可以参考一下这个学习路线。

详细的可以到“如鹏网”上去了解一下,有网络的地方就可以学习,有更多的时间来练习,有新的课程更新了,也是可以接着来学习的。

很高兴回答你的问题

学python入门是理解编程是啥,真正的python核心你还没有触碰到!

想了解Django,建议去淘宝上购买相关书籍。这里简单介绍一下Django,它是一种web框架。既然是框架,它就包含了很多模块层!

学习Django要理解命令行和开发工具的结合使用。因为在创建Django,是在命令行中输入指令完成。

其实不管是学习Python爬虫、数据分析、还是往前端方向靠,都需要很专注的去学习,最重要的是,一天至少给自己两小时的敲代码投入。

话不多说,书籍可以淘宝上找,但这个文档学习网站却是小白不知道的。这里分享给你,希望你能学有所成!

网站链接:

***s://***.python.org/

不仅可以学习Django,还可以学习其他的内容。如果觉得文档看不懂的,可以留言哦!

更多精彩,敬请期待!

谢谢邀请

想要学习Python Web开发,主要需要学习Djangotornadoflask,同时你还需要知道数据库mysqloracle操作,还有前端知识,htmlCSSjs

Django

学习Django,个人觉得Django自强学堂(***s://code.ziqiangxuetang***/django/django-tutorial.html)的教程非常不错,从零开始到后面的项目[_a1***_]还是非常详细的。在学习的时候不要一味的看,要多敲多思考,有的东西可能刚开始不是特别了解,当随着学习的深入,慢慢的你就会了解了。

Python中文社区

在Python中文社区(***s://docs.pythontab***/)里面有很多的学习手册,有时间也可以去多看看。

慕课网

有的时候可能单纯的看文档和书学习效率并不是特别高,这时候可以结合一些好的***教程一起看看(***s://***.imooc***/course/list?c=python),慕课网上面的教程还是非常多的。

建议

最后给点小建议,对于在校学生来说,因为你们会缺少项目经验,所以一定要多自己敲几个项目,这样你们的简历也会好看些,对你们找工作也会很有帮助,有机会的话可以去实习

到此,以上就是小编对于python3数据分析学习笔记的问题就介绍到这了,希望介绍关于python3数据分析学习笔记的5点解答对大家有用。

标签: 数据分析 Python 学习